Darline Graham Wins SC GOP Senate Runoff Over Ralph Norman

TL;DR Summary
Darline Graham is projected winner of the South Carolina Senate primary runoff, defeating Ralph Norman 52.5% to 47.5% with about 99% of votes tallied and roughly 800 votes remaining; county results show Graham carrying several counties while Norman leads in others, sealing the statewide margin.
